The Crack and Crevice Strategy:

Here’s the thing: sealing cracks and crevices is an incredibly efficient way to keep these pesky critters at bay. Most pest problems begin with those sneaky little entry points. Rodents can squeeze through an opening no bigger than a quarter, and insects? Well, they’re just as crafty! When you seal those gaps in walls, floors, and around utility lines, you significantly reduce the chances of pests making their grand entrance.

What to Avoid:

Now, let’s break down what NOT to do.

  • Leaving food exposed to air: This isn’t a just ‘no’—it’s a recipe for disaster! Exposed food can attract all kinds of unwanted guests.
  • Storing food in open containers: This one makes it too easy for pests to snack on your ingredients. You wouldn’t leave the doors to your pantry wide open, would you?
  • Maintaining a cluttered environment: Cluttered spaces are like a five-star hotel for pests. They find hiding spots and go unnoticed until it's too late.
